FAQS
1. What is the minimum age requirement to enroll in a driving school?
The minimum age requirement to enroll in a driving school typically varies by location, but in most places, students must be at least 15 or 16 years old to begin driving lessons. However, it’s essential to check with your local driving school for specific age requirements.
2. What documents do I need to bring to my first driving lesson?
For your first driving lesson, you should bring a valid learner’s permit or driver’s license, any required identification (such as a government-issued ID), and possibly a parent or guardian if you’re under a certain age. Additionally, wearing comfortable clothing and closed-toe shoes is recommended.
3. How many lessons will I need before I can take the driving test?
The number of lessons required before taking the driving test varies depending on the individual’s skills and comfort level. On average, students may need between 5 to 20 lessons. Your instructor can assess your progress and recommend when you’re ready for the test.
4. Are the driving lessons one-on-one or in a group setting?
Most driving schools offer one-on-one lessons, allowing for personalized instruction and a tailored learning experience. However, some schools may provide group classes for theoretical knowledge, while practical lessons are often conducted individually.
5. What happens if I miss a scheduled lesson?
If you miss a scheduled lesson, it’s important to contact your driving school as soon as possible. Most schools have cancellation and rescheduling policies, which may allow you to make up the lesson without losing your fees, but specific terms can vary. Always review your school’s policies for details.
